Released in the dynamic cinematic landscape of 2002, Maximum Velocity (V-Max) emerges as a significant entry in the Drama, Action domain. The narrative core of the film focuses on a sophisticated exploration of In search of purpose, 17-year-old Claudio helps easygoing mechanic Stefano build a car capable of winning a street race that could solve his financial problems, but gets himself involved with the latter's former girlfriend.
